| #ifndef BOOST_TT_IS_POD_HPP_INCLUDED |
| #define BOOST_TT_IS_POD_HPP_INCLUDED |
| |
| #include <cstddef> // size_t |
| #include <boost/type_traits/detail/config.hpp> |
| #include <boost/type_traits/is_void.hpp> |
| #include <boost/type_traits/is_scalar.hpp> |
| #include <boost/type_traits/intrinsics.hpp> |
| |
| #ifdef __SUNPRO_CC |
| #include <boost/type_traits/is_function.hpp> |
| #endif |
| |
| #include <cstddef> |
| |
| #ifndef BOOST_IS_POD |
| #define BOOST_INTERNAL_IS_POD(T) false |
| #else |
| #define BOOST_INTERNAL_IS_POD(T) BOOST_IS_POD(T) |
| #endif |
| |
| namespace boost { |
| |
| // forward declaration, needed by 'is_pod_array_helper' template below |
| template< typename T > struct is_POD; |
| |
| template <typename T> struct is_pod |
| : public integral_constant<bool, ::boost::is_scalar<T>::value || ::boost::is_void<T>::value || BOOST_INTERNAL_IS_POD(T)> |
| {}; |
| |
| #if !defined(BOOST_NO_ARRAY_TYPE_SPECIALIZATIONS) |
| template <typename T, std::size_t sz> struct is_pod<T[sz]> : public is_pod<T>{}; |
| #endif |
| |
| |
| // the following help compilers without partial specialization support: |
| template<> struct is_pod<void> : public true_type{}; |
| |
| #ifndef BOOST_NO_CV_VOID_SPECIALIZATIONS |
| template<> struct is_pod<void const> : public true_type{}; |
| template<> struct is_pod<void const volatile> : public true_type{}; |
| template<> struct is_pod<void volatile> : public true_type{}; |
| #endif |
| |
| template<class T> struct is_POD : public is_pod<T>{}; |
| |
| } // namespace boost |
| |
| #undef BOOST_INTERNAL_IS_POD |
| |
| #endif // BOOST_TT_IS_POD_HPP_INCLUDED |
